Test-Statistic
A value calculated from sample data during a hypothesis test that is used to determine whether to reject the null hypothesis.
Two-Tail Test
A statistical test that determines the significance of a parameter by considering both ends (tails) of the distribution to test for extreme values.
Null Hypothesis
A hypothesis used in statistics that proposes no statistical significance exists in a set of given observations.
Level Of Significance
The threshold below which a p-value must fall for an effect or difference to be considered statistically significant in hypothesis testing.
